Fruit yogurt parfaits recipe

This gloriously nutritious parfait is full to the brim with gorgeous fruits, from tropical kiwi and pineapple to juicy mango and blueberries. What's more, this beautiful breakfast bowl can be whipped up in just 20 minutes, and contains all the vitamin C you need in a day. See method
Ingredients
- 2 large bananas, peeled
- 200g low-fat natural yogurt
- 1-2 tbsp honey, to taste
- 350g frozen blueberries
- 4 passion fruits, halved
- 2 kiwi fruit, peeled and sliced into rounds
- 1 papaya, peeled, halved, seeded and sliced
- 2 x 80g packs mango and pineapple fingers, chopped
- 4 tbsp pomegranate seeds
- 4 tbsp gluten-free granola

Method
- Roughly chop a banana and put in a blender with the yogurt, 1 tbsp honey, 300g frozen blueberries and the scooped-out flesh from 4 passion fruit halves. Whizz until smooth.
- Divide the mixture between 4 shallow serving bowls.
- Slice the remaining banana and arrange with the remaining passion fruit halves and blueberries, the kiwi, papaya, mango, pineapple, pomegranate seeds and granola on top. Serve immediately.
